Understanding Odds and Probabilities

At the heart of any successful wagering strategy lies a thorough understanding of odds and probabilities. Different betting platforms present odds in various formats – decimal, fractional, and American – and it's crucial to be able to convert between them to accurately assess potential returns. However, odds are not merely about potential payouts; they also reflect the implied probability of an event occurring. A higher odd suggests a lower probability, and vice versa. Experienced punters don’t just look at the odds; they compare them across different bookmakers to identify value bets – those where the implied probability is lower than their own assessment.

Calculating expected value is a fundamental skill. The formula is relatively simple: (Probability of Winning Potential Payout) – (Probability of Losing Stake). A positive expected value indicates a potentially profitable bet over the long run. It’s important to remember that this is a theoretical calculation and doesn’t guarantee success on any single bet. The law of large numbers suggests that maximizing bets with positive expected value will yield profit, but variance can lead to short-term losses. Understanding concepts like margin or “vig” – the commission built into the odds by the bookmaker – is also critical. A lower margin translates to better odds for the bettor.

Odd Format Example Explanation
Decimal 2.50 Represents the total payout for every £1 staked, including the return of the stake.
Fractional 5/2 Represents the profit relative to the stake. £2 staked returns £5 profit plus the original £2 stake.
American +250 Represents the profit you would win on a £100 stake.

Accurately interpreting these different formats enables punters to make informed choices, irrespective of their preferred wagering platform. Moreover, refining one's ability to assess probability independently, rather than solely relying on bookmaker implied probabilities, is a significant step towards long-term success.

Developing a Strategic Approach to Wagering

A haphazard approach to wagering rarely yields consistent results. A well-defined strategy is essential, encompassing bankroll management, sport specialization, and a clear understanding of betting markets. Bankroll management involves setting aside a specific amount of money dedicated solely to wagering and adhering to strict staking limits. A common recommendation is to never stake more than 1-5% of your bankroll on a single bet. This helps mitigate risk and prevents catastrophic losses. Sport specialization involves focusing on a limited number of sports or leagues, allowing for a deeper understanding of the nuances, team dynamics, and relevant statistics. Trying to be an expert in everything often leads to diluted knowledge and poor decision-making.

Different betting markets offer varying levels of risk and reward. Moneyline bets are the simplest, requiring you to simply pick the winner of an event. Spread bets involve a handicap, and you must predict whether a team will win or lose by a certain margin. Over/Under bets focus on whether a specific statistic (e.g., total goals scored) will be higher or lower than a predetermined number. Prop bets allow you to wager on specific events within a game, such as a player scoring a touchdown or a team receiving a certain number of yellow cards. Understanding the intricacies of each market, and identifying those where you have a competitive edge, is crucial for building a successful strategy.

  • Research is Key: Thoroughly analyze team form, player statistics, and historical data.
  • Value Betting: Identify bets where the odds provided by the bookmaker exceed your own assessed probability.
  • Diversification (with caution): Spreading bets across different sports or markets can reduce risk, but avoid over-diversification.
  • Emotional Control: Avoid chasing losses or making impulsive bets based on emotion.
  • Record Keeping: Track your bets and analyze your results to identify strengths and weaknesses.

Consistent record-keeping and diligent post-match analysis aren’t merely ‘good practice’ but essential for identifying areas for improvement and refining one’s strategic approach. This iterative process of evaluation and adaptation is what separates consistent winners from casual bettors.

The Role of Data Analytics in Modern Wagering

The availability of comprehensive data has revolutionized the world of sports wagering. Advanced statistical models and machine learning algorithms can now be used to analyze vast datasets and identify patterns that would be impossible for a human to detect. These tools can provide insights into team performance, player tendencies, and even the impact of external factors such as weather conditions. However, data analytics is not a silver bullet. It requires careful interpretation and a healthy dose of skepticism. Models are only as good as the data they are trained on, and unforeseen events can always disrupt even the most sophisticated predictions.

Many online platforms now offer access to a wealth of data and analytical tools, ranging from basic statistics to advanced visualizations and predictive models. Understanding how to utilize these resources effectively is a significant advantage. It's also important to be aware of the limitations of data. Past performance is not necessarily indicative of future results, and statistical anomalies can occur. Using data to inform your decisions, rather than blindly following its predictions, is the key to successful implementation. Furthermore, focusing on niche or less-covered sports or leagues can sometimes yield an advantage, as the level of data analysis is likely to be lower, creating opportunities for astute punters to exploit inefficiencies.

  1. Gather relevant data from reliable sources.
  2. Clean and preprocess the data to remove errors and inconsistencies.
  3. Select appropriate statistical models or machine learning algorithms.
  4. Train and validate the models using historical data.
  5. Interpret the results and apply them to your wagering strategy.
  6. Continuously monitor and refine your models based on new data.

The ability to effectively leverage data analytics is becoming increasingly crucial in competitive wagering environments. However, it’s essential to approach these tools with a critical mindset, understanding both their potential and their limitations.

Risk Management and Responsible Gambling

Wagering inherently involves risk, and responsible gambling is paramount. Regardless of your skill level or the sophistication of your strategy, losses are inevitable. Therefore, it’s vital to have a robust risk management plan in place. This includes setting strict budget limits, avoiding chasing losses, and never wagering more than you can afford to lose. It's also important to recognize the signs of problem gambling and seek help if necessary. Numerous organizations offer support and resources for individuals struggling with gambling addiction.

Diversifying your bets across different events and markets can help to reduce overall risk, but it doesn’t eliminate it entirely. Hedging your bets – placing multiple bets on different outcomes of the same event – can also be a useful risk management technique, but it requires careful execution and can reduce potential profits. Furthermore, understanding the psychological biases that can influence decision-making is crucial. Confirmation bias, for example, can lead you to selectively focus on information that confirms your existing beliefs, while anchoring bias can cause you to overemphasize initial information. Awareness of these biases can help you make more rational and objective decisions.
